SY 2017-18 vs SY 2024-25About BAYLESS ELEMENTARY
BAYLESS ELEMENTARY, a roomy primary school in ST LOUIS, Missouri, one of the schools within BAYLESS, serves 858 students, covering grades pre-K through 5. That puts it 172% above the typical public school in Missouri, which averages around 315 students.
BAYLESS comprises 3 schools with combined enrollment of 1,805 students; BAYLESS ELEMENTARY is among them.
For racial and ethnic makeup, BAYLESS ELEMENTARY logs that White students make up the majority at 64%; the rest consists of 11% Black, 11% Asian, 8% multiracial, 6% Hispanic. Compared to St. Louis County overall, the school's racial mix sits in roughly the same range.
On the income-and-resources front, On paper, BAYLESS ELEMENTARY has 59 full-time-equivalent teachers, translating to a class-load average of around 14.5:1. The state averages around 12.4:1, so this campus is higher than the state norm typical. Roughly 57% of students at BAYLESS ELEMENTARY q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, often used as a Title I proxy. Set against St. Louis County (around 43%), the school's rate is somewhat above typical.
On a demographically-adjusted basis, BAYLESS ELEMENTARY sits in the middle band of the BeatsExpectations distribution. Schools with this campus's student mix typically land near 50.2%; this one delivers 60.0%.
In the broader community, St. Louis County reports that median household earnings sit near $82,936, about 47% of the adult population holds a bachelor's degree or above, and roughly 7% of residents live below the federal poverty line. In all, St. Louis County runs 275 public schools (combined enrollment of about 134,601 students), of which BAYLESS ELEMENTARY is one.
BAYLESS JUNIOR HIGH is the nearest neighboring public school, about 0.1 miles from this campus. Counting just inside five miles, 8 other public schools cluster around BAYLESS ELEMENTARY. On composite proficiency, BAYLESS ELEMENTARY comes 5th of 9 in the immediate cluster, beneath the nearby-schools average of 66.0%.
Geographically, the school is in a suburban area.
Over the past 7-year window. BAYLESS ELEMENTARY's enrollment has showed little movement since 2018, when it stood at 860 (now 858).
